Dialing in the Perfect Humidity for Your 'De Smelt'

🌡 What 'De Smelt' Loves

Echeveria desmetiana 'De Smelt' thrives in moderate humidity. This sweet spot ensures plump leaves and a vibrant appearance. Too dry or too moist, and you'll see signs of stress on your succulent's foliage.

πŸ“ Measuring Up

Hygrometers are your best friends for keeping tabs on humidity. Pair it with keen observation, and you'll know exactly when to tweak the environment for your 'De Smelt'. Remember, temperature swings can also affect moisture levels, so keep an eye on both.

When the Air's Too Dry

πŸ’§ Boosting Humidity Around Your 'De Smelt'

In the quest for optimal humidity for your Echeveria desmetiana 'De Smelt', dry air is the enemy.

🌬 Humidifiers: Your Personal Oasis Creator

A humidifier is the go-to gadget for a consistent moisture boost. It's like signing a peace treaty with the dry air demons. Keep it clean to prevent your plant's personal rain cloud from turning into a bacteria party.

πŸͺ¨ Pebble Trays: The Low-Tech Lifesaver

The pebble tray is the unsung hero of humidity. Just grab a tray, toss in some pebbles, add water, and set your plant on top. The slow evaporation is a steady sip of humidity for your 'De Smelt', without the risk of overwatering.

🌿 Plant Buddy System: The More, The Merrier

Grouping plants is like throwing a humidity party. They share moisture through transpiration, creating a microclimate that's just right. It's a simple, yet effective way to up the humidity without adding gadgets to your space.

Remember, while boosting humidity, keep an eye on the levels. You're aiming for that sweet spot where your 'De Smelt' thrives, not a tropical jungle vibe.

When Moisture's Too Much

🌧️ Bringing Down the Humidity

In the fight against high humidity, your Echeveria desmetiana 'De Smelt' might need a little help. Here's how to dial it down.

Ventilation Hacks

Crack a window. It's the oldest trick in the book, but it works. Fresh air ushers out the stale, moist air that your succulent loathes. If you're not into the idea of an open invitation for bugs, a fan can be your next best friend. Get it oscillating to mimic a gentle, drying breeze.

The Role of Dehumidifiers and Fans

When the air feels like a wet blanket, it's time for the big guns. Enter: the dehumidifier. This gadget is like the moisture police, patrolling the air and keeping dampness in check. Pair it with a fan to circulate the drier air for a one-two punch against humidity. Just remember to choose a dehumidifier that fits the size of your spaceβ€”too powerful, and you'll turn your tropical oasis into a desert wasteland.

Adapting to Your Local Humidity

🌡 Making Your 'De Smelt' Feel at Home

Local climate is the stage on which your Echeveria desmetiana 'De Smelt' performs. It doesn't do costume changes, so you'll need to adjust the set to keep the show running smoothly.

Seasonal shifts in humidity aren't just a topic of small talk; they're critical cues for your 'De Smelt's' care routine. In the winter chill, your home becomes a desert, thanks to that furnace chugging away. Your move? Group plants together or set up a pebble tray to create a microclimate that doesn't leave your succulent high and dry.

Come summer, the script flips. Humidity can skyrocket, and your 'De Smelt' might start to feel like it's in a sauna. Air circulation is your best friend here. Crack a window, or let a fan dance around your plant to keep the air moving. It's like giving your 'De Smelt' a breath of fresh air without the risk of a humidity hangover.

Hygrometers are your backstage passes to the humidity show. Keep one handy to know when to bring the house lights down or when to amp up the moisture. Just remember, your 'De Smelt' isn't looking for a plot twist; consistency is key to keeping those rosettes happy.

As the seasons turn, don't just throw a blanket over your plant and hope for the best. Monitor and adjustβ€”that's the mantra of a savvy plant parent. Your 'De Smelt' depends on you to read the room, or in this case, the air.
